Which one has a real existence
(a) Phylum
(b) Class
(c) Genus
(d) Species

The correct Answer is:
To determine which of the given options has a real existence, we need to analyze each taxonomic category mentioned in the question: 1. **Phylum**: This is a high-level taxonomic category that groups together organisms based on certain shared characteristics. However, it is an abstract classification and does not represent a specific, tangible group of organisms. 2. **Class**: Similar to phylum, class is another taxonomic category that further divides organisms within a phylum. Classes are also theoretical constructs used for classification purposes and do not have a real existence. 3. **Genus**: A genus is a rank in the biological classification that groups species that are closely related. While it is more specific than phylum and class, it still serves as a classification tool and does not represent a real, distinct entity. 4. **Species**: This is the most specific taxonomic category and refers to a group of organisms that can interbreed and produce fertile offspring. Species have a real existence because they represent actual populations of organisms in nature. Based on this analysis, the correct answer is: **(d) Species** - Species have a real existence as they represent groups of interbreeding populations.
